Sarah Jessica Parker may be a lady of luxury, but she wants to bring fabulous clothing to the masses at affordable prices. Since we already know that her clothing line Bitten will be inexpensive (we're talking each article under $20), now we can all dress like SJP!
The collection was named after her reaction to walking into a Steve & Barry’s store for the first time - she was "bitten."

Finally, a bit of British holiday in the heart of New York City! Heidi Klein started in London in 2002 with a vacation-centric store. The founders, Heidi Gosman and Penny Klein both appreciated how difficult it was to shop for holiday essentials and a well fitting swim suit.

It has been reported that "Girls Gone Wild" is launching an apparel line with a cheeky tag that reads: "When Clothing Isn't Optional!"
Joe Francis, founder, at the age of 23, of the ten year old business called Girls Gone Wild believes that his new line of apparel will be worth anywhere from $40 - $60 million within the next two years. His empire is currently worth approximately $100 million.
